About Loïc Calvez
Loïc Calvez is Co-Founder and CEO of ALCiT. Over the last 25 years, he had the privilege to work with small and large organizations, as a client buying solutions and as a vendor selling them. Most of them were in highly compliant verticals such as finance, energy, and pharma, covering multiple compliance bodies in North America and Western Europe (SOC, NERC, HIPAA, FDA, PCI, PIPEDA …) giving him great exposure to the nuances of the world.
Today, via ALCiT, Loïc is focusing on building secure solutions that work in the real world as well as speaking at events to help raise awareness around Cybersecurity. ALCiT specializes in taking large enterprise tools, packaging them through standardized configuration, and making them available to Small and Medium Business helping them become and stay Cybersecure.
